## Changelog — v2.9.1: resolver defaults changed

Heads up, on-call: we finally changed the DNS defaults after last month's flaky resolution saga in the Bramblehook cluster. The resolver now caches negative responses for a shorter window and retries against a secondary upstream instead of hammering the same one. Net effect: fewer spurious connection failures, slightly more resolver traffic. If you see lookup latency spikes, check the retry counters before rolling back. The new defaults shipping with this release are listed here.

deployment values, kajep-kageg:
[praix]
host = praix.paliqcorp.corp
user = praix_svc
database = praix_prod

Since Tuesday, autocomplete on the Marwick storefront has been returning suggestions in 800ms+ instead of the usual sub-100ms. The index itself looks healthy; query volume is normal. Comparing node configs, three of the six suggest-svc hosts appear to have reverted to pre-rollout settings after last week's reimage — shard cache and prefix depth differ from what we deployed. On-call: please reconcile the drifted hosts against the canonical values, which are reproduced below.

deployment values, tafog-kagap:
wenath:
  pin: 4244
  metrics_host: metrics.wenath.lumicsys.internal
  tenant: istix
  seal: seal_10585894

Quarterly Planning Note — Department Heads

Topic: Renewal of the Ardelune Components supply contract

The current Ardelune agreement expires at quarter end. Procurement recommends a two-year renewal with a 3% volume discount and revised delivery windows for the Torvik plant. Legal has cleared the draft terms; quality metrics over the past year were within tolerance. A fallback supplier, Merrowgate Industrial, remains qualified if talks stall. Please review capacity assumptions before Thursday. The confidential rationale is appended below.

confidential, tahop-hahap: The board signed off on a budget of $192.1 million for Project Zordor.

Handover — Vexler partner SFTP drop

Ownership moves to you today. Drop runs hourly from Vexler's end into the intake bucket via the relay host. Watch for zero-byte files; their exporter flakes on Mondays. Creds live in the ops vault, path noted in the runbook. Vault auto-seals after 48h idle. Support escalations go to the on-call rotation, not me. If the vault is sealed when you need it, unseal with the recovery passphrase below.

recovery phrase for tadug-fafof: zorwyn-kasion